Horror in Niger: Mob Burns Woman Alive Over Alleged Blasphemy

A tragic incident unfolded in Kasuwan Garba, Mariga Local Government Area of Niger State, where a female food seller identified as Ammaye (also spelled Amaye) was lynched and set ablaze by an angry mob over alleged blasphemy against Prophet Muhammad. The event, which occurred on a Saturday evening, has been confirmed by local authorities, including the Chairman of Mariga LGA, Abbas Adamu, and the Spokesperson for the Niger State Police Command, SP Wasiu Abiodun.
According to eyewitnesses and multiple reports, the face-off began at Igwama, a nearby community, where Ammaye, who was also a Muslim and well-known as a food vendor, reportedly exchanged words with a young man said to be her nephew.
